Color Analysis Summary

Color #46A182, historically referred to as Mint, is a beautifully balanced color tone. Mathematically, in the RGB (Red, Green, Blue) spectrum, this color is formulated by mixing 27% red, 63% green, and 51% blue. These digital components translate to exact numerical values of Red: 70, Green: 161, and Blue: 130. In terms of web formatting, this exact tone is declared in stylesheets using the hex code #46A182. For designers working with cylindrical coordinates, its HSL values are mapped to a hue angle of 160°, a saturation of 39%, and a lightness index of 45%. In the HSV (Hue, Saturation, Value) model, it retains a brightness value of 63%. Because of its specific lightness, this tone offers distinct visual contrast properties.
